A Marine is welcomed by his family at Pier 15 South Harbor in Manila as he comes home from Marawi City where he fought the IS-insipred Maute terrorist group. RUSSELL PALMA 

A CONTINGENT composed of more than 500 personnel of the Philippine Navy who fought the Islamic State-linked Maute group in Marawi City for five months arrived in Manila to a heroes’ welcome on Monday.
